**Mgmt Meeting Minutes — Retiring the Brightline Range**

Quick recap for sales leads at Fenholt Supplies: we agreed to retire the Brightline fixture range by year-end. Remaining stock moves to clearance pricing next month, and accounts on standing orders get migrated to the Lumetta range. Trade-in incentives were approved in principle. The confidential note on next steps sits just below.

board note of bajof-bajeg: The pricing group signed off on a budget of $13.4 million for Project Sildor. The renewal with Lamixek Holdings closes at $48.9 million a year, 49 percent above the last contract.

The Orvane Labs bike cage and the east and west parking gates operate on separate access schedules, and facilities desk staff should note that visitor vehicles may only use the west gate between 07:00 and 19:00. Cyclists requesting cage access must show a valid day pass, and their details should be entered in the access ledger before the cage is opened. Gates must never be propped open, even briefly, during deliveries. When a manual override is required at either gate, use the code below.

staff pass of fadup-fawig = bdg-FUNKS-4

ONBOARDING — Sproutly scheduler. You're on call for the watering planner that drives valve controllers in the Fernwick greenhouse fleet. Schedules recompute nightly at 02:00 from soil-moisture telemetry; if the job stalls, controllers fall back to their last plan for 48 hours, so nothing wilts immediately. Alerts route through the Dripwatch channel. Most pages are telemetry gaps — check the ingest queue depth first. Manual replans go through the internal planner API, which requires per-request auth. The on-call key for that service is below.

API key for yahig-tadup: kto7_ubizbYm

Context for the sync: the Meridia conversion service accumulated sub-cent rounding drift, and the reconciliation job auto-locked affected merchant accounts as a precaution. Recovery requires restoring each account's ledger snapshot, replaying conversions with banker's rounding enabled, and verifying the drift report shows zero residual. Do not skip the verification step; unlocking before replay reintroduces the drift. To decrypt the ledger snapshot archive during this procedure, use the recovery passphrase provided below.

unlock words, hahip-baduf: holwyn-istath-julvan